Hunting the Ruby Valley

The landscape alone makes hunting in this part of Montana something out of a dream. Rack & Reel specializes in fair chase private land hunts for elk, mule deer, whitetail, black bear, mountain lion, pronghorn antelope, and bison. With their 1:1 and 2:1 guided hunts, each experience is tailored to the guest’s needs, whether it’s an archery adventure deep in September’s crisp mornings or a late-season rifle trip through the frosty November hills.

Their all-inclusive packages include lodging, meals, beverages, and everything else you’d need short of your own boots. They’ll even drop your animal off for taxidermy and meat processing. For those chasing that rare big game combo, this crew knows where to go and how to get you there.

Fishing: Dry Flies and Drift Boats

When the rivers warm and the bugs hatch, Rack & Reel shifts gears to their other passion: fly fishing. As a trusted fishing guide in Montana’s trout-laden waters, they offer guided trips on the Big Hole, Beaverhead, Madison, and Jefferson Rivers. These aren’t just day trips. These are river days that feel like chapters in a good book.

Whether you’re after browns or rainbows, Rack & Reel’s team provides everything you need, from the latest gear to the local wisdom on what’s biting. Their all-inclusive fly fishing packages include lodging and meals, or guests can book day trips and pair fishing with other adventures.

Seasons, Licenses, and How to Book

Montana’s hunting and fishing seasons vary widely depending on species and method. Rack & Reel helps clients navigate application deadlines, license fees, and regulations through personalized service. A 35% deposit secures your spot—your bed and your guide—and trips are handled case-by-case. Whether you’re eyeing elk in September or casting flies in July, timing is everything, and the team is ready to help you plan it right.
